Melanie also has significant experience representing workers who “blew the whistle” and reported Medicare and other fraud conducted by their employers against federal and state governments. These cases, called “qui tam” cases, permit an employee who has not participated in the fraud to bring a lawsuit on behalf of the government in order to recover on its behalf. Individuals who bring these suits are described as “relators,” and, in certain situations, they are entitled to share in the government’s recovery.
